Sky Wireless, located at 1016 W Rosecrans Ave in Gardena, California, is a beloved local cell phone store that has garnered a stellar reputation with a 4.8-star rating from over 100 reviews. Customers frequently praise the excellent service and the owner’s dedication to helping them with their mobile needs, whether it’s fixing a phone or recovering a lost number.
With a wide variety of phones and accessories available, Sky Wireless stands out for its friendly atmosphere and commitment to customer satisfaction, making it a go-to destination for residents seeking reliable mobile solutions.
